[Tutorial] CMP741D Jellybean Install

mastermind278

Member
Jan 13, 2013
28
9
**The written instructions are in a more consider order and easier to follow, I will be adding
annotations on video in the things I changed.**

What you need:
1. Craig CMP741D
2. Windows Computer
2. USB Cable
3. MicroSD Card

************************************
DISCLAIMER: I AM NOT RESPONSIBLE IF YOU BRICK / RUIN YOUR TABLET IN ANY WAY.
************************************
Before I get started I recommend you make a NANDROID of your CMP741D (with the Original firmware).
To do this you can follow my CWM install -
http://www.androidtablets.net/forum...l-craig-cmp741d-cwm-install-instructions.html
Once your in CWM you can do a Nandroid Backup
************************************************** *************

This would not be possible without Oma7144 and his JB! Thank you!

Let's get started.

First lets get started by downloading a bunch of files:
1. You need to download OMA7144's RK2918 Jellybean, it can be found on his thread on XDA: RK2918 Tab Odys-Loox rocks with Jelly Bean ! - xda-developers
At the time of this tutorial, you need to download download v1.2.2a.
2. Download Oma JB v1.1 Format NAND.zip which can also be found on the above thread on XDA.
3. Download CWM-TOUCH from OMA7144 (As the cmp741D does not have Volume buttons) - xda-developers - View Single Post - RK2918 Tab Odys-Loox rocks with Jelly Bean !
3. Download the CMP741D Kernel which I dumped from my 741D - Dev-Host - kernel.img - The Ultimate Free File Hosting / File Sharing Service
4. Download Mastermind278's CMP741D Model Fix - Dev-Host - ModelFix-CMP741Dv120.zip - The Ultimate Free File Hosting / File Sharing Service (This one is at 120 dpi) OR Dev-Host - ModelFix-CMP741D_signed.zip - The Ultimate Free File Hosting / File Sharing Service (At 160 dpi) **Pick which one you want to use**
5. OPTIONAL - Normal Mount ZIP - It mounds the intSD and NAND. http://crewrktablets.arctablet.com/?wpfb_dl=327
I did not install this on the Video but I prefer it installed so I installed after.

Now that we have all these files we need to do some moving around:
1. Extract the OMA7144's RK2918 Jellybean (Oma_Odys_Loox_JB_4.1.1_v1.2.2a.7z) onto your DESKTOP.
2. Navigate to the rockdev folder, then click on Image folder and you should see all the image files. At this point rename Kernel.img to Kernel_ORIG.img and Recovery.img to Recovery_Orig.img.
3. Open CWM-TOUCH (Oma_RK29_CWM_touch.7z) and extract the recovery.img in the archive to the Rockdev/image folder (where you just renamed the other files).
4. Copy Mastermind278's Kernel.img also into this folder.
5. Plugin the microSD to the computer.
6. Copy - Oma_JB_v1.1_Format_NAND.zip, ModelFix-CMP741Dv120.zip or ModelFix-CMP741D_signed.zip (PICK ONE), and Oma_intSD_to_NAND_OTG_fix.zip (Optional).
7. Eject microSD, plugin into CMP741D.

At this point you need to turn OFF your TABLET.
1. Navigate to RKAndroid_v1.29 folder and right click RKAndroidTool.exe choose Run as Administrator.
2. Now Press the ESC button (right most button) on the tablet (while it's turned off) and plugin the USB cable. The screen will remain black on the tablet. Let go of the button when RKAndroidTool says found RKAndroid Loader **You might have to install the drivers for your tablet at this point. Open device manager and under other devices you will see Unknown Device, point to the USB Driver folder on the OMA7144 Extracted folder.
3. Put a check mark on LOADER and press EraseIDB. Wait for the prompt and press OK.
4. Uncheck Loader and press RUN. This will take a while so be prepared to wait.
5. Once done, the tablet should boot to CWM.

Now you should have the microSD already in the CMP741D.
1. Scroll to Install zip from SD (Using the down pentagon)
2. Choose Install zip from SDCard
3. Pick Oma_JB_v1.1_Format_NAND.zip, scroll to YES and enter.
4. Now repeat going to Install Zip from SD, Choose zip from SD
3. Install ModelFix-CMP741Dv120.zip or ModelFix-CMP741D_signed.zip (PICK ONE)
4. Install Oma_intSD_to_NAND_OTG_fix.zip (Optional).
5. Choose Reboot System.
System will now take 5-10 minutes to boot up. After booting up I also recommend waiting another 5-10 minutes to let everything settle.

At this point Jellybean should be working nicely on the tablet!

Enjoy!
---------
Bugs: ?? I think the battery indicator is off... but I haven't allowed enough time to verify this.
---> As per Oma7144 it was recommended to install Akkufix2 found here: http://crewrktablets.arctablet.com/?wpfb_dl=317

-----
$Screenshot_2013-01-21-19-18-33[1].png$Screenshot_2013-01-21-19-18-53[1].png$Screenshot_2013-01-21-19-19-20[1].png$Screenshot_2013-01-21-23-00-24.png
 
Last edited by a moderator:

wfg97079

Member
Jan 14, 2013
16
0
Any chance on something similar on a CMP741E?
**The written instructions are in a more consider order and easier to follow, I will be adding
annotations on video in the things I changed.**

What you need:
1. Craig CMP741D
2. Windows Computer
2. USB Cable
3. MicroSD Card

************************************
DISCLAIMER: I AM NOT RESPONSIBLE IF YOU BRICK / RUIN YOUR TABLET IN ANY WAY.
************************************
Before I get started I recommend you make a NANDROID of your CMP741D (with the Original firmware).
To do this you can follow my CWM install -
http://www.androidtablets.net/forum...l-craig-cmp741d-cwm-install-instructions.html
Once your in CWM you can do a Nandroid Backup
************************************************** *************

This would not be possible without Oma7144 and his JB! Thank you!

Let's get started.

First lets get started by downloading a bunch of files:
1. You need to download OMA7144's RK2918 Jellybean, it can be found on his thread on XDA: RK2918 Tab Odys-Loox rocks with Jelly Bean ! - xda-developers
At the time of this tutorial, you need to download download v1.2.2a.
2. Download Oma JB v1.1 Format NAND.zip which can also be found on the above thread on XDA.
3. Download CWM-TOUCH from OMA7144 (As the cmp741D does not have Volume buttons) - xda-developers - View Single Post - RK2918 Tab Odys-Loox rocks with Jelly Bean !
3. Download the CMP741D Kernel which I dumped from my 741D - Dev-Host - kernel.img - The Ultimate Free File Hosting / File Sharing Service
4. Download Mastermind278's CMP741D Model Fix - Dev-Host - ModelFix-CMP741Dv120.zip - The Ultimate Free File Hosting / File Sharing Service (This one is at 120 dpi) OR Dev-Host - ModelFix-CMP741D_signed.zip - The Ultimate Free File Hosting / File Sharing Service (At 160 dpi) **Pick which one you want to use**
5. OPTIONAL - Normal Mount ZIP - It mounds the intSD and NAND. http://crewrktablets.arctablet.com/?wpfb_dl=327
I did not install this on the Video but I prefer it installed so I installed after.

Now that we have all these files we need to do some moving around:
1. Extract the OMA7144's RK2918 Jellybean (Oma_Odys_Loox_JB_4.1.1_v1.2.2a.7z) onto your DESKTOP.
2. Navigate to the rockdev folder, then click on Image folder and you should see all the image files. At this point rename Kernel.img to Kernel_ORIG.img and Recovery.img to Recovery_Orig.img.
3. Open CWM-TOUCH (Oma_RK29_CWM_touch.7z) and extract the recovery.img in the archive to the Rockdev/image folder (where you just renamed the other files).
4. Copy Mastermind278's Kernel.img also into this folder.
5. Plugin the microSD to the computer.
6. Copy - Oma_JB_v1.1_Format_NAND.zip, ModelFix-CMP741Dv120.zip or ModelFix-CMP741D_signed.zip (PICK ONE), and Oma_intSD_to_NAND_OTG_fix.zip (Optional).
7. Eject microSD, plugin into CMP741D.

At this point you need to turn OFF your TABLET.
1. Navigate to RKAndroid_v1.29 folder and right click RKAndroidTool.exe choose Run as Administrator.
2. Now Press the ESC button (right most button) on the tablet (while it's turned off) and plugin the USB cable. The screen will remain black on the tablet. Let go of the button when RKAndroidTool says found RKAndroid Loader **You might have to install the drivers for your tablet at this point. Open device manager and under other devices you will see Unknown Device, point to the USB Driver folder on the OMA7144 Extracted folder.
3. Put a check mark on LOADER and press EraseIDB. Wait for the prompt and press OK.
4. Uncheck Loader and press RUN. This will take a while so be prepared to wait.
5. Once done, the tablet should boot to CWM.

Now you should have the microSD already in the CMP741D.
1. Scroll to Install zip from SD (Using the down pentagon)
2. Choose Install zip from SDCard
3. Pick Oma_JB_v1.1_Format_NAND.zip, scroll to YES and enter.
4. Now repeat going to Install Zip from SD, Choose zip from SD
3. Install ModelFix-CMP741Dv120.zip or ModelFix-CMP741D_signed.zip (PICK ONE)
4. Install Oma_intSD_to_NAND_OTG_fix.zip (Optional).
5. Choose Reboot System.
System will now take 5-10 minutes to boot up. After booting up I also recommend waiting another 5-10 minutes to let everything settle.

At this point Jellybean should be working nicely on the tablet!

Enjoy!
---------
Bugs: ?? I think the battery indicator is off... but I haven't allowed enough time to verify this.
---> As per Oma7144 it was recommended to install Akkufix2 found here: http://crewrktablets.arctablet.com/?wpfb_dl=317

-----
View attachment 9822View attachment 9823View attachment 9824View attachment 9829
 
Last edited by a moderator:

craigtabuser

Member
Dec 24, 2012
8
0
big thanks to you mastermind and oma! Anyone else involved. This is above and beyond. Finally get netflix on my cmp741d.

Any upcoming fix for VPN (tun.ko) or USB keyboard? I plugged in a usb keyboard to the mini port no luck. Currently making an adapter to try on the Full Size USB cause I think that's the host port. Will post if successfull


Thanks again!
 

mhunt13

Member
Nov 15, 2012
7
3
Thank you mastermind! An awesome tutorial for Jellybean!

I also have the CMP741d tablet, by reading a lot I have rooted it and have Gapps installed. Very happy with the way it works right now.

Would like to update to Jellybean someday, though hesitant to do that without a full backup and a way to revert to it. So I'd like to get the touch CWM working on it so I can do a backup. I followed your link in 1st post to the CWM touch download, which is only the recovery.img file.

I do not know how to get this recovery.img installed on my tablet. Can you share an easy way to do that?? I'd really appreciate any help.
 

bolton

Member
Jan 22, 2013
4
0
Thanks Mastermind! I installed the rom last night and most things are working correctly (including Netflix!). Multitouch appears not to be working (pinch to zoom) and the volume control is missing from the taskbar (I'm using button savior for a shortcut). Thanks again! ;)
 

mastermind278

Member
Jan 13, 2013
28
9
Multitouch does work on my tablet. I tried it on both Chrome and with Multitouch Tester (shows 5 points).

$IMG_20130122_155707.jpg

As for the volume control yes it was eliminated. I was actually contemplating making a fix that reprograms the MENU and ESC button to Volume UP and Volume Down (easily done change the keychar).
 

bolton

Member
Jan 22, 2013
4
0
I figured out my problem. I was using an older version of dolphin browser (flash compatible) that apparently doesn't like multitouch input on my tablet. I updated dolphin and everything (except for flash) is working fine. Thank you so much for putting this together.
 

mastermind278

Member
Jan 13, 2013
28
9
Glad that fixed the issue. You should be able to use Flash via the AOSP browswer too.

As for TUN and Overclock, unfortunately without the source code for the kernel, one cannot rebuild the kernel completely to add those 2 modules.
 

drewsands

Member
Jan 25, 2013
1
0
Everything is working Netflix, Crackle etc. Angry Birds does not work tryed 4 different versions from amazon app store play store and the other. Thanks in advanced. Update: Uninstalled and reinstalled changed dpi from 120 to 160. 160 works better on a side note but not for angry birds.
 
Last edited:

DerpyTails

Member
Aug 31, 2012
21
4
ROM Works Great and it fixed my signing-in issue with the My Little Pony Gameloft Game :D

EDIT: 1. Thanks for also helping me with installing a working CWM for the tablet and 2. The one thing that bothers me is that the icons for the Notification Clear (The X for when you check on what's in your Notifications) and the Volume Up and Down Icons are not showing up, any way on how to fix this?
 
Last edited:

mastermind278

Member
Jan 13, 2013
28
9
ROM Works Great and it fixed my signing-in issue with the My Little Pony Gameloft Game :D

EDIT: 1. Thanks for also helping me with installing a working CWM for the tablet and 2. The one thing that bothers me is that the icons for the Notification Clear (The X for when you check on what's in your Notifications) and the Volume Up and Down Icons are not showing up, any way on how to fix this?

The Jellybean notfication is different from ICS. To clear out you use the _-[SUP]- [/SUP] there no longer is a X.
As for the volume, there are a few apps that will add the volume indicators.

I might redo the modelfix in the coming days/weeks depending on how busy I get to hopefully add them. Personally I am leaning to reasigning the volume buttons to the Menu and Esc button (if people like that).
 

DerpyTails

Member
Aug 31, 2012
21
4
The Jellybean notfication is different from ICS. To clear out you use the _-[SUP]- [/SUP] there no longer is a X.
As for the volume, there are a few apps that will add the volume indicators.

I might redo the modelfix in the coming days/weeks depending on how busy I get to hopefully add them. Personally I am leaning to reasigning the volume buttons to the Menu and Esc button (if people like that).

Thanks for that, I never knew
that JB's bar was THAT different

Sent from my Craig CMP741D using Tapatalk 2
 

DerpyTails

Member
Aug 31, 2012
21
4
Yep, Go to Craig Electronics' Official Website (craigelectronics.com), go to E-Digital, then go to CMP741D and scroll down to the "Download" link and download the archive, after that, extract the update.img from the folder within the archive into the MicroSD card, then insert the MicroSD Card into the Tablet and when it asks to update, select Yes twice and it'll reboot and install the firmware for you :)

Sent from my Craig CMP741D using Tapatalk 2
 
Last edited:
Top